**Ticket #4471 — Vault locked after Shrinkray pipeline migration**

Hey future folks. The Shrinkray image-slimming job at Corvid Systems stopped pulling base-layer signing keys because the Tanagra vault sealed itself after last week's node reboot. Nobody re-keyed it, classic. If this happens again: don't rebuild the vault, just unseal it and re-run the slimming stage — the distroless layers cache fine afterward. I'm parking the unseal procedure here so we stop pinging Odile at midnight. The passphrase you need is directly below this line.

vault phrase of hahop-badug = novvan-ulaion-zorius-noviel-gorwyn-casix-tamys

**Ticket PKT-88: Webhook fires twice on parcel handoff**

For whoever inherits this: the Cartwheel parcel-tracking webhook double-fires when a package moves from the Delven hub to a courier within the same minute. Downstream, Merrow's notifier then texts customers twice. Root cause looks like a missing idempotency check in the handoff event coalescer. Repro steps attached. The offending deploy is identified by the token below.

trace token, hawep-hadug: htk3_9c2

## Sensor drift: what to do at 3am

If the GrowLoop controller starts reporting humidity swings that don't match the backup probes in the Fernwick greenhouse, it's almost always sensor drift, not an actual climate event. Don't panic and don't touch the vents manually. First, restart the calibration daemon and give it ten minutes to re-baseline. If readings still disagree by more than 5%, flip the controller into safe mode. The safe-mode thresholds it will use are these.

config for yahap-bajof:
[istix]
host = istix.qorvelsys.internal
user = istix_svc
database = istix_prod

## Idempotency Keys for Payment Retries (Lumopay)

Every retry of a charge request must reuse the original idempotency key; generating a new key on retry can produce duplicate charges. Keys are scoped per merchant and expire after 48 hours. Reviewers should verify keys are derived server-side, never from client input. The full key-generation specification and threat model are maintained on the internal page.

dashboard of kaguf-tawip = https://vault.merlaqsys.test/issue